Little Bit of Walk
Raises Little Bit of Money
Contributed by Glen
Wondsel
On
Sunday, April 14th, the fourth annual "Little Bit of a
Walk" took another stride towards helping families with
children with cancer. The walk raises money for "Making
Headway," A family support group that helps the families of
Brain Cancer Patients. Elizabeth Ryan lost her battle to the
decease. With the help of her family, the walk continues the
ongoing need to raise funds to support victims and their
families when they need the support the most.
Diane Ryan, Elizabeth's mother, could
not imagine how successful this years walk would be. "We
gave away all the shirts, and there were about 600 of them"
Diane Ryan said. "I still don't believe we raised over
20,500 dollars on this walk!". The Ryans had some help in
this success. This year the walk was able to raffle off
autographed memorabilia from local sports teams.
Many thanks From the Ryan family to the
organizers and workers who volunteered their time to this event,
O.L.M.M. Church and Long Beach Catholic School, not to mention
all the runners and walkers who braved the 78 degree heat.
